S.A.G. Solarstrom AG: Result of first quarter of 2012 according to plan

- Sales EUR21.4 million, EBIT -EUR2.8 million
- High positive cash flow from operating activities of EUR157.8 million

Freiburg, May 10, 2012. S.A.G. Solarstrom AG (German security
identification number: 702 100, ISIN: DE0007021008) closed the first
quarter of 2012 with sales of EUR21.4 million (Q1 2011: EUR78.9 million)
and an EBIT of -EUR2.8 million (Q1 2011: EUR5.1 million). S.A.G. Solarstrom
AG is thus on schedule for the business year 2012, for which the Group has
announced a significant increase in sales volume (2011: 100 MWp) with a
positive EBIT. In the previous year's quarter, sales and EBIT had been
influenced to a very great extent by the large-scale Serenissima project.
In the first quarter of 2012 the business area Project Planning and Plant
Construction was not able to profit from pull-forward effects in Germany
due to the very short lead time of the announced amendments to the
Renewable Energy Act (EEG). Preproduction costs for further project
activities over the course of the year also diminished the result in this
business area. Partner Sales remained under pressure due to the high level
of competition in Germany. In addition, financing costs for the large-scale
Serenissima project were also borne by the S.A.G. Solarstrom Group up to
the completion of the sales process on March 30, 2012 and thus influenced
the Group period result, which was negative at -EUR4.2 million.

Project Planning and Plant Construction with preproduction costs
Sales in the business area Project Planning and Plant Construction were
EUR8.7 million (Q1 of 2011: EUR68.9 million due to the large-scale
Serenissima project), and EBIT was negative at -EUR3.2 million (Q1 of 2011:
EUR3.9 million) due to preproduction costs for further project activities.
The S.A.G. Solarstrom Group's Direct Sales had focused on the closure of
the sales process for the Serenissima project, as well as on initiating and
contractually finalizing further projects in Germany and abroad over the
further course of the year. In addition, Sales was not able to profit from
the pull-forward effects in Germany due to the amendments to the Renewable
Energy Act (EEG), which were given at very short notice.

Strong competitive pressure in Partner Sales
The business area Partner Sales increased sales in the first quarter,
compared with the same period in the previous year, by 43.4% to EUR6.8
million (Q1 of 2011: EUR4.7 million). The strong price competition for
photovoltaic systems, particularly in the German market, continued unabated
however, so that the EBIT was negative at -EUR0.4 million (Q1 of 2011:
EUR0.2 million).

Plant Operation and Services
The business area Plant Operation and Services increased sales in
comparison with the previous year's period by 8.1% to EUR4.5 million (Q1 of
2011: EUR4.1 million). The increase in photovoltaic systems monitored by
the S.A.G. subsidiary meteocontrol GmbH to 26,000 with a total output of
4.9 GWp made a considerable contribution to this. EBIT remained stable in
comparison with the previous year's period at EUR0.8 million, despite the
costs for further international expansion.

Power Production
Sales in the business area Power Production increased by 19.1% to EUR1.4
million in comparison with the previous year's quarter (Q1 of 2011: EUR1.1
million). In 2011, the company's own power plant portfolio was extended by
a 5.1 MWp ground-mounted system in Kamenicna, Czech Republic, as well as
with an almost 1 MWp rooftop system in Dortmund. EBIT was EUR0.05 million
as a result of seasonal effects. In Q1 of 2011, the EBIT was higher, due to
a special effect in conjunction with the photovoltaic system Kamenicna, at
EUR0.2 million.

High cash flow from operating activities
At December 31, 2011 the 48 MWp project in North Italy still led to
temporary balance sheet effects, including a negative operational cash
flow, high debt and, as a result, a low equity ratio. Some effects have
already been leveled out in the balance sheet at March 31, 2012. The S.A.G.
Solarstrom Group thus disclosed a high positive operational cash flow of
EUR157.8 million at March 31, 2012 (December 31, 2011: -EUR61.3 million),
the debt fell again considerably at March 31, 2012 due to the repayment of
the EUR80 million project bridging loan and the equity ratio increased to
18.2% (December 31, 2011: 14.5%). Nevertheless, the balance sheet still
showed certain key date-related effects of the large-scale project at March
31, 2012. With the settlement of most of the liabilities from the
large-scale project in April, these key figures have continued to improve
considerably.

About S.A.G. Solarstrom AG

S.A.G. Solarstrom AG (German security identification number: 702 100, ISIN:
DE0007021008) of Freiburg i.Br., Germany, is a manufacturer-independent
provider of high-quality photovoltaic plants configured to customers'
individual needs. The Group constructs efficient plants of all sizes both
in Germany and abroad. S.A.G. Solarstrom AG also produces solar energy at
its own plants.

S.A.G. Solarstrom AG's service portfolio covers the entire life cycle of
photovoltaic plants, including forecast and energy services, yield reports,
and remote service and maintenance, as well as insurance and financing. The
Group thus offers a comprehensive value chain in photovoltaics, from yield
reports, planning, construction, operations, and monitoring to
optimization, repowering, and deconstruction.

Founded in 1998, S.A.G. Solarstrom AG is considered a pioneer in the solar
industry. Around 230 specialists work at the four locations in Germany and
the foreign subsidiaries.

S.A.G. Solarstrom AG is listed in the Prime Standard of the Frankfurt Stock
Exchange as well as according to the rules and standards m:access of the
Munich Stock Exchange.
